Circuit City = Greedy Bastards

Unbelievable.

Circuit City has proudly announced that it is firing about 3,400 employees who were paid above the market rate. They're firing them presumably because those employees made the mistake of being, you know, good employees. Or alternatively made the mistake of staying with Circuit City too long.

And they're going to replace them with new hires at a lower rate.

I'm not kidding. Here's Circuit City's news release about it, and in case they take it down, here's a key excerpt:
The company has completed a wage management initiative that will result in the separation of approximately 3,400 store Associates. The separations, which are occurring today, focused on Associates who were paid well above the market-based salary range for their role. New Associates will be hired for these positions and compensated at the current market range for the job.
